Output 31b012796b9e62fbf5b13f28e660571cb155d783a7a8b76e5a5a64fd751c4827:0

value
252400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ebf1f32faf393b2fc077dcff51781d659cfa3f0 OP_EQUALVERIFY OP_CHECKSIG
address
1E1mucyud2Z6WaUpkvBobUidnznVekt6BD
transaction
31b012796b9e62fbf5b13f28e660571cb155d783a7a8b76e5a5a64fd751c4827
confirmations
368552
spent
true